**Alert: SeatCanvas render latency exceeded threshold**

The SeatCanvas renderer for the Gildermere Playhouse venue template is taking longer than 1200 ms to paint seat maps with more than 800 seats. Plugins that inject custom seat overlays are the most common cause, as overlay callbacks block the main render pass. If your plugin registers overlay hooks, verify they complete within the 50 ms budget. Mitigation steps, profiling instructions, and the overlay performance checklist are documented on the internal runbook page below.

dashboard of tawef-hagug = https://superset.norvadyn.local/display/projects/build/ticket/build/spaces/ticket/1e989f0e6c200d20fc4ae06b

## Idempotency Keys for Payment Retries (Lumopay)

Every retry of a charge request must reuse the original idempotency key; generating a new key on retry can produce duplicate charges. Keys are scoped per merchant and expire after 48 hours. Reviewers should verify keys are derived server-side, never from client input. The full key-generation specification and threat model are maintained on the internal page.

dashboard of kaguf-tawip = https://vault.merlaqsys.test/issue

## Support

Offline mode in TrailCensus caches survey forms and queued submissions on-device, syncing when connectivity returns. Plugin authors should assume storage quotas of roughly 50 MB per form bundle and must not write outside the sandboxed cache directory. Conflict resolution is last-write-wins unless your plugin registers a merge handler. If you hit sync behavior that contradicts the API docs, or need a quota exception, reach the platform team at the address below.

escalation mailbox, bafog-fafog: ulador@paliqlabs.internal

Postmortem timeline — Crumbleton Bakery cutoff bug

14:05 — Support flags that customers in the Ostwick region can still place next-day orders after the 2pm cutoff. 14:20 — Turns out the cutoff rule in Ovenline compares against server time, not bakery-local time, so Ostwick got a bonus hour. 14:45 — Dario ships a hotfix pinning cutoff checks to each bakery's timezone. 15:10 — Backfill cancels the six late orders; support comped them. For the record, the hotfix deploy's trace token is noted just below.

pipeline stamp: htk21_86b657ac0aa916a9af17f